Best Quotes about Life
Life is raw material. We are artisans. We can sculpt our existence into something beautiful, or debase it into ugliness. It's in our hands.
Better, Cathy
Life is a solitary cell whose walls are mirrors.
O'Neill, Eugene
Towns are excrescences, gray fluxions, where men, hurrying to find one another, have lost themselves.
Forster, Edward M.
What I like about cities is that everything is king size, the beauty and the ugliness.
Brodsky, Joseph
Do not take life too seriously; you will never get out of it alive.
Hubbard, Elbert
I have done my fiddling so long under Vesuvius that I have almost forgotten to play, and can only wait for the eruption and think it long of coming. Literally no man has more wholly outlived life than I. And still it's good fun.
Stevenson, Robert Louis
Life is a great surprise. I don't see why death should not be an even greater one.
Nabokov, Vladimir
The only reason they come to see me is that I know that life is great -- and they know I know it.
Gable, Clark
The cities of America are inexpressibly tedious. The Bostonians take their learning too sadly; culture with them is an accomplishment rather than an atmosphere; their Hub, as they call it, is the paradise of prigs. Chicago is a sort of monster-shop, full of bustles and bores. Political life at Washington is like political life in a suburban vestry. Baltimore is amusing for a week, but Philadelphia is dreadfully provincial; and though one can dine in New York one could not dwell there.
Wilde, Oscar
